About Sk Ziaul
Sk Ziaul is a scholar working on Environmental Engineering,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is and Global and Planetary Change, having authored 12 papers that have together received 843 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Urban Heat Island Mitigation (8 papers), Land Use and Ecosystem Services (7 papers) and Urban Green Space and Health (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Environmental Engineering (535 citations), Global and Planetary Change (570 citations) and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is (279 citations). Sk Ziaul has collaborated with scholars based in India, Bangladesh and Sweden. Frequent co-authors include Swades Pal, Swades Pal, Swapan Talukdar, Abu Reza Md. Towfiqul Islam, Kutub Uddin Eibek, Javed Mallick, Nguyễn Thị Thùy Linh, Susanta Mahato, Babak Mohammadi and Quoc Bao Pham.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Environmental Science and Pollution Research and Ecological Indicators.
